Eli Martin

Eli C. (Big Eli) Martin, 77, of Ashland, KY passed away peacefully at his home Saturday, January 12, 2019. A Memorial Service will be held at 11 a.m. Saturday, January 19 at St. Paul Lutheran Church in Postville with Reverend Lynn Noel as the officiant. Visitation will be for one hour before services at the church. Interment will follow in Postville Cemetery, Postville.

In lieu in flowers, donations may be made to Shriners Hospitals for Children, ATTN: Office of Development, 2900 N. Rocky Point Drive, Tampa, FL 33607 or www.shrinershospitalforchildren.org/shc/donate.

From an early age, Eli worked hard in whatever job he worked whether it was farming and/or regular employment. He worked for and retired in 2007 after 41 years as a Federal Food Inspector with the USDA. He was also a member of the Mailhandlers Union.

He enjoyed wood working and loved to fish. Most of all, he loved being a dad and grandparent. He was always ready to share his vast knowledge and have those around him learn what he had to teach.

He is preceded in death by parents, Minda Askelson Martin, William Martin and Nellie Martin; his wife, Doloris Parker Martin; his sisters, Minda Irene Martin, Francis Griffin, Bert Barr and Cletus Beal; and his brothers, Alvin Martin, Bill Martin and Clayton Martin.

Eli is survived by his loving wife, Gladys Hensley Sutton Martin of Ashland, KY; his brother, Harlan Martin; his children, Deborah (David) Loftsgard, Elaine (Larry) Rice, David (Rosemary) Martin, Eli C. Martin II, Earlene (George) Opell, Carolyn (Jim) Vipperman and Jerry (CeCe) Sutton; 24 grandchildren and 44 great-grandchildren; as well as a host of nieces, nephews and other beloved friends and relatives.
